... Respondents Prayer: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ution praying to 1/6

issue a Writ of Certiorarified Mandamus, calling for the records of the 3rd respondent in Na.Ka.No.1433/A4/2023 dated 12.03.2025 and quash the same and consequently direct the respondents to grant approval of the appointment of Kennady Christopher with effect from 01.03.2019 in the post of Secondary Grade Teacher in the petitioner school with all service and monetary benefits by taking into account the fact that the appointment was made prior to the issuance of G.O.Ms.No.165 dated 17.09.2019 and that the petitioner school is a minority school and TET cannot be insisted upon with all monetary and service benefits.

O R D E R

This Writ Petition has been filed challenging the order dated 12.03.2025 on the file of the third respondent thereby rejecting the approval of appointment of K.Kennady Christopher with effect from 01.03.2019 in the 2/6

post of Secondary Grade Teacher in the petitioner's School.

2. The petitioner's School is a minority institution under the Management of the Arcot Lutheran Church. While being so, a vacancy arose due to promotion of one Marilyn Serena Chellakumari as Headmistress of the petitioner's School with effect from 01.03.2019. In the said vacancy, one K.Kennady Christopher was appointed as Secondary Grade Teacher with effect from 01.03.2019. Thereafter, the petitioner had sent a proposal to approve the appointment of him as a Secondary Grade Teacher. However, it was rejected on two grounds i.e., already on the same dates there was a surplus of teachers in the post of Secondary Grade Teacher and the concerned teacher failed to qualify in Teacher Eligibility Test (TET).

3. The learned counsel for the petitioner would submit that G.O.Ms.No.165 prohibited the approval of appointment where there is a surplus. Thereafter, the said G.O.Ms became inoperative and as such, on the ground of surplus the approval of the appointment to the post of Secondary Grade Teacher cannot be rejected. She further submitted that the petitioner's 3/6

school is a minority institution and as such, the Teacher Eligibility Test (TET) is not applicable to the case of the petitioner.

4. The learned counsel for the third respondent filed a counter affidavit and I have perused the counter affidavit and also the submissions made by Mrs.S.Mythreye Chandru, learned Special Government Pleader.

5. The petitioner has failed to ensure that there are no surplus teachers available in the School for the Management before filing the Writ Petition vacant post.

6. Three surplus posts of Secondary Grade Teacher were available in the other School of the same Danish Mission Corporate Management as per the students strength as on 01.08.2024. In fact, now there are three surplus teachers who are very much available in the post of Secondary Grade Teacher as on 01.08.2024. On the date of appointment that is on 01.03.2019 there was surplus post and hence, the appointment of Mr.K.Kennady Christopher cannot be approved and the proposal was rightly rejected by the third respondent and hence, this Court finds no infirmity or illegality in the order 4/6

passed by the third respondent.

7. In the result, this Writ Petition is dismissed. No costs. 18.11.2025 Index:Yes/No dna To 1.The Director of School Education DPI Campus, Chennai 600 006.
